body,td{
	margin: 0 auto;
	font-family: Georgia, Arial, sans-serif;
	font-size: 0.8em;
	color: #474545;
	line-height: 1.5em;
	}
h1.titolo{font-size: 1.3em; color:#006699;}

h2.sottotitolo{font-size: 0.9em;}
span.autore{
	clear:both;
	float: right;
	font-size: 0.9em;
	text-align:right;
	padding: 3px;
	color: #9C9A9C;
	text-decoration: none;
}
span.autore a{
	color: #9C9A9C;
	text-decoration: none;
}
a:link,a:visited{
	color:black;
	text-decoration:none;
}
a:hover{
	color: #316AC5;
	text-decoration:underline;
}
.imgSinistra {
	display:block; 
	float: left; 
	padding:3px;
	border: 1px solid #A1BBD5; 
	margin: 5px 5px 5px 5px;
}

.imgDestra {
	display:block; 
	float: right;
	padding:3px;
	border: 1px solid #A1BBD5; 
	margin: 5px 5px 5px 5px;
	
	}
.foto1 {
	display:block; 
	float: right;
	padding:3px;
	border: 1px solid #A1BBD5; 
	margin: 5px 5px 5px 5px;
	
	}
	
/*MENU*/

ul.menu{
	margin:0;
	padding-left:20px;
}
ul.menu li{
	list-style-image: url('immagini/lista.gif');
	margin:0;
	padding:0;
}
ul.menu li a:link, ul.menu li a:visited {
	color: #006699;
	text-decoration: none;
}
ul.menu li a:hover, ul.menu li a:active{
	text-decoration: underline;
}

ul.menu2{
	margin:0;
	padding-left:20px;
}
ul.menu2 li{
	list-style-image: url('immagini/lista.gif');
	margin:0;
	padding:0;
}
ul.menu2 li a:link, ul.menu2 li a:visited {
	font-size: 0.85em;
	color: #006699;
	text-decoration: none;
}
ul.menu2 li a:hover, ul.menu2 li a:active{
	text-decoration: underline;
}

/* PUBBLICITA' */
.pubblicita{
	text-align:center;
	background: #BBC8D6;
	border: 1px solid #A1BBD5;
	display: block;
	height: auto ;
	padding: 0;
	width: 125px;
	list-style: none;
	margin:30px 0 auto;
	}
	
.pubblicita li{
	padding-top:15px; 
	padding-bottom:15px;
	}

.pubblicita li a img{border:0;}
/* SOMMARIO */
.sottosezione{margin-left:20px;}
/*span.editoriale{font-size:1.1em; font-weight:bold; padding:3px; border:1px solid #7D8E96;}*/
span.editoriale, span.rubriche, span.articoli , span.inserto, .activeTab, .nonActiveTab{
	font-size:1.1em; font-weight:bold; padding:3px 10px 0 3px;
	color: #FFF;
	background: url(ad2.gif) no-repeat top right;
}
span.editoriale {
	background-color: #7D8E96;
}
span.rubriche, .activeTab {
	background-color: #6DA1DA;
}
span.articoli, .nonActiveTab {
	background-color: #A2CA36;
}
span.inserto {
	background-color: #65022E;
}
ul.editoriale{list-style-type:none;}
/*span.rubriche{font-size:1.1em; font-weight:bold; padding:3px; border:1px solid #6DA1DA;}*/
ul.rubriche li {font-weight:bold; padding:5px;}
ul.rubriche ul li{font-weight:normal; padding:0;}
.parliamo{clear:left;font-size:1.1em;  border-bottom: 1px solid #9F0251; border-left: 5px solid #9F0251; padding-left:3px;font-weight:bold; margin-bottom:7px; margin-top:7px;}

div.minitesto{
	display: block;
	float: left;
	text-align: center;
	font: 0.8em verdana,sans-serif;	
	padding:2px 1px 2px 1px;
	border: 1px solid green;

}
a.valid:link,a.valid:visited {
	background: #FF6600;
	color: #FFFFFF;
	text-decoration: none;
	padding: 1px;
}
a.valid:hover {
	background: #FFFFFF;
	color: #BBC8D6;
	text-decoration: none;
}
.nonActiveTab, .activeTab{
	display:block;
	float:left; 
	clear:right:
	font-size:.9em; font-weight:normal; padding:2px 10px 3px 3px; margin-right:1px; text-decoration:none;
	color: #FFF;
	background: url(ad2.gif) no-repeat top right;
}
.activeTab {
	background-color: #6DA1DA;
}
.nonActiveTab {
	background-color: #BBC8D6;
}
.nonActiveTab:hover {
	background-color: #6DA1DA;
}
#tab{
	display:block;
	float:right;
	margin:5px;
	width:520px;
}
#contenitoreDiv{
	clear:both;
	height:200px;
	border: 1px solid #6DA1DA;
	padding: 10px;
}
.clear{
	clear:both;
	line-height:0;
	visibility:hidden;
}